Next is seeking permanent staff to join their transport team in Hemel, England. The role involves transporting clothing and homeware products across the UK, with AM shifts on a 5-over-7 pattern. Successful candidates will benefit from training and support.

Pay rates are competitive, with day rates of £18.05 to £23.05 per hour depending on the day, and night rates up to £25.60 per hour.

A valid Class 1 C+E licence and at least one year of driving experience are required.
